2010 Buick Enclave vs. 2010 Subaru Forester

To start off, both 2010 Buick Enclave and 2010 Subaru Forester were released in the same year (2010). Therefore the support and the availability on parts for both vehicles should be relatively similar. At 3,600 cc (6 cylinders), 2010 Buick Enclave is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2010 Buick Enclave (288 HP @ 6300 RPM) has 64 more horse power than 2010 Subaru Forester. (224 HP @ 5200 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2010 Buick Enclave should accelerate faster than 2010 Subaru Forester.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2010 Buick Enclave weights approximately 599 kg more than 2010 Subaru Forester.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2010 Subaru Forester is all wheel drive (AWD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2010 Buick Enclave.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2010 Subaru Forester will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2010 Buick Enclave (366 Nm @ 3400 RPM) has 60 more torque (in Nm) than 2010 Subaru Forester. (306 Nm @ 2800 RPM). This means 2010 Buick Enclave will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2010 Subaru Forester.

Compare all specifications:

2010 Buick Enclave 2010 Subaru Forester
Make Buick Subaru
Model Enclave Forester
Year Released 2010 2010
Body Type SUV SUV
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 3600 cc 2500 cc
Engine Cylinders 6 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type V boxer
Valves per Cylinder 4 valves 4 valves
Horse Power 288 HP 224 HP
Engine RPM 6300 RPM 5200 RPM
Torque 366 Nm 306 Nm
Torque RPM 3400 RPM 2800 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Drive Type Front AWD
Transmission Type Automatic Automatic
Number of Seats 7 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 5 doors 5 doors
Vehicle Weight 2168 kg 1569 kg
Vehicle Length 5126 mm 4559 mm
Vehicle Width 2007 mm 1781 mm
Wheelbase Size 3020 mm 2616 mm
Fuel Consumption 9.8 L/100km 9.8 L/100km
Fuel Consumption City 13.8 L/100km 12.4 L/100km
Fuel Tank Capacity 83 L 64 L
